We provide the following interventions: (i) expert advice on electricity conservation (Information/Knowledge treatment), (ii) information about (average) electricity consumption of others in the city (City/Suburb treatment) , and (iii) information about own electricity consumption relative to comparable neighbors' electricity consumption (Neighbor treatment); and (iv) no intervention - control group.
Intervention (Hidden) Results from the First three phases of interventions in 2017 show that information/knowledge treatment is the most effective treatment in household energy conservation. In order to check the true efficacy of the Information treatment, we provided the Information/Knowledge treatment to randomly selected half (approximately 600 households) of both Suburb and Neighbor treatment groups in April-May 2018. Randomly selected half (approximately 600 households) of initial Control and Information/Knowledge treatment groups served as the control in our follow-up intervention. Almost an equal number of households (approximately 300) was selected from each initial treatment wing. In the follow-up phase in April-May 2018, we provided the information treatment and collected the households' electricity use information. We conducted a final follow up survey in August 2018 to collect electricity use information of all (approximately 1200 households) households' electricity use information for May-June and June-July 2018.
